About this House

Brand new construction in Westbrook Village! This spacious 2,100 sq. ft. residence sits on a desirable corner lot within a beautifully established neighborhood. It features 4 bedrooms, 2 full baths and a huge, covered patio space. 2 car garage + tandem bay! NO HOA's! You'll love the location - It backs right up to Hansen Park, has access to the East Bend Canal Trail and is only a short walk away from Gardenside Park!

  • Patriciaoregon
    "Because I value my health above all else, I chose Gardenside as my neighborhood. Here, it's easy to get sunshine, fresh air and plenty of exercise -- I walk out the door and indulge not only complete safety in the neighborhood, but also on the many trails (along the beautiful canal and in the BLM). The inspiring views of the Cascades also entice me outdoors! Also, from here, I can walk to the neighborhood farm (Field's Farm) for fresh produce all year around (they have a commercial green house). Many of my neighbors love to walk, too, so it's easy to find friends to join me. As for weather, I like the micro climate here in Gardenside - more sun and much less snow and ice than on Bend's westside. As for a healthy social life and community, the middle of the Gardenside neighborhood is a well-maintained park with a lovely stone-and-timber Pavillion -- a great place to meet with friends, family and neighbors for BBQ, playing our musical instruments, indulging conversation, relaxing with a good book, or meeting with our laptops. Neighbors here really look out for each other and take good care of each other. That means a lot to me. As for getting out and about ... Since I'm only 3 miles from the Old Mill District and Bend's (charming) downtown, I waste no time fighting traffic to get to the art galleries, restaurants, theater, symphony and the nationally acclaimed Friday Art Walks. Of all the places I've lived in the US, I've been happiest (and healthiest!) while living in Gardenside."
